- Deputies stopped Hadid at Gator’s Cantina in Weatherford, Texas, minutes before Banuelos approached them, according to the report.
- The arresting officer documented slurred speech, bloodshot and glassy eyes, and an odor of alcohol as Banuelos spoke to police.
- Banuelos admitted to drinking four beers and consented to a field sobriety test, after which the officer determined he was intoxicated and took him into custody to prevent potential driving.
- His white truck was left running with a dog inside, which Banuelos said belonged to Hadid, the documents state.
- Banuelos was briefly booked at Parker County Jail and released after paying $386, and officers released his property and vehicle to Hadid, whom the report identifies as his girlfriend.
